I played around with this today:

- I'm totally convinced that we should replay by swapping out stdin with a file 
from the reproducer. This makes this better overall.
- I'm not convinced that capturing just stdin is an improvement. What I like 
about the current approach is that we don't have to bother with the `-o`/`-S` 
commands when replaying. We already have a mechanism to deal with them so I 
don't think it's unreasonable to piggyback on it, especially because this is 
how we display it to the user. On the other hand, I generally try to keep the 
code path the same between the regular and reproducer case, and processing the 
command line options in the reproducer case would reuse more of the existing 
code. Finally, we'd have to figure out a way to test this, because currently we 
rely on the commands provided/sourced through the command line to test the 
replay. How would we test this functionality when only capturing from stdin?
